 A resident of Monument, Colorado, Joe Bohler was born in Montana and grew up on a ranch just north of Great Falls. He became a workshop instructor at the Scottsdale Artists' School and is a nationally recognized artist, one of the reasons being he is a founding member of the Northwest Rendezvous group.
He is a six-time winner of the C.M. Russell Auction's Best of Show Award, a signature member of the American Watercolor Society, and the Allied Artists of America and a member of the National Academy of Western Art, where he won two gold medals.
In 1994, he was commissioned to paint the famed actor, country singer, and songwriter Tex Ritter.
In spring 2000, he was one of two artists featured in the Gilcrease Museum Rendezvous Exhibit in Tulsa, Oklahoma.
His date of birth is recorded as 1938, 1940, or 1943. |
